Usage in Deno
import { pbkdf2Sync } from "node:crypto";
pbkdf2Sync(): Buffer
Provides a synchronous Password-Based Key Derivation Function 2 (PBKDF2)
implementation. A selected HMAC digest algorithm specified by digest is
applied to derive a key of the requested byte length (keylen) from thepassword, salt and iterations.
If an error occurs an Error will be thrown, otherwise the derived key will be
returned as a Buffer.
The iterations argument must be a number set as high as possible. The
higher the number of iterations, the more secure the derived key will be,
but will take a longer amount of time to complete.
The salt should be as unique as possible. It is recommended that a salt is
random and at least 16 bytes long. See NIST SP 800-132 for details.
When passing strings for password or salt, please consider caveats when using strings as inputs to cryptographic APIs.
const { pbkdf2Sync, } = await import('node:crypto'); const key = pbkdf2Sync('secret', 'salt', 100000, 64, 'sha512'); console.log(key.toString('hex')); // '3745e48...08d59ae'
An array of supported digest functions can be retrieved using getHashes.
